首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用/时出错;矩阵尺寸必须一致

使用/时出错是指在编程过程中使用除法运算符时出现错误。这种错误通常是由于被除数和除数的类型不匹配或者除数为零导致的。

在编程中,除法运算符(/)用于执行除法操作,将一个数除以另一个数并返回商。然而,当被除数和除数的类型不匹配时,会导致使用/时出错。例如,如果被除数是一个整数而除数是一个浮点数,或者反过来,就会出现类型不匹配的错误。

另外,当除数为零时,也会导致使用/时出错。这是因为在数学中,除以零是没有定义的,所以编程语言会抛出一个异常或错误来指示除数为零的情况。

解决使用/时出错的方法包括:

  1. 确保被除数和除数的类型匹配。如果需要,可以使用类型转换操作符将它们转换为相同的类型。
  2. 在进行除法运算之前,检查除数是否为零。可以使用条件语句(如if语句)来判断除数是否为零,并在除数为零时采取相应的处理措施,如输出错误信息或进行异常处理。

矩阵尺寸必须一致是指在进行矩阵运算时,参与运算的矩阵的行数和列数必须相等。矩阵是一个二维数组,由行和列组成。在进行矩阵运算时,需要确保参与运算的矩阵的尺寸一致,否则会导致矩阵运算失败。

例如,两个矩阵相加的操作要求这两个矩阵的行数和列数都相等。如果两个矩阵的尺寸不一致,就无法进行相加操作。

解决矩阵尺寸必须一致的方法包括:

  1. 在进行矩阵运算之前,检查参与运算的矩阵的尺寸是否一致。可以使用条件语句(如if语句)来判断矩阵的行数和列数是否相等,并在尺寸不一致时采取相应的处理措施,如输出错误信息或进行异常处理。
  2. 在进行矩阵运算时,可以使用矩阵运算库或函数,这些库或函数通常会在进行矩阵运算之前自动检查矩阵的尺寸,并在尺寸不一致时抛出异常或错误。

总结: 使用/时出错通常是由于被除数和除数的类型不匹配或者除数为零导致的,解决方法包括确保类型匹配和检查除数是否为零。矩阵尺寸必须一致是指在进行矩阵运算时,参与运算的矩阵的行数和列数必须相等,解决方法包括检查矩阵尺寸是否一致和使用矩阵运算库或函数。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共17个视频
动力节点-JDK动态代理(AOP)使用及实现原理分析
动力节点Java培训
动态代理是使用jdk的反射机制,创建对象的能力, 创建的是代理类的对象。 而不用你创建类文件。不用写java文件。 动态:在程序执行时,调用jdk提供的方法才能创建代理类的对象。jdk动态代理,必须有接口,目标类必须实现接口, 没有接口时,需要使用cglib动态代理。 动态代理可以在不改变原来目标方法功能的前提下, 可以在代理中增强自己的功能代码。
领券